NO. Human shampoos are NOT safe for use on pets. Please consult a reputable groomer, pet store or veterinarian before ever using human products on pets. Many products that are safe for humans (example: Tylenol) will kill a cat. Human shampoos have a different pH level than shampoos used for pets.





I agree with the majority of people who have answered that you don't need to bathe your cat. Cats are self-grooming, and if you continue to bathe your cat, he or she will eventually stop grooming themselves. If you insist upon bathing the cat, or your cat no longer self-grooms, then be sure you use a gentle cat shampoo only on your pet.

I write this from experience. Regular bathing of cats really isn't necessary as many of the others that wrote a response said. Occasionally tho, it's ok to bathe a cat. If you think the cat really needs a bath it's fine to use baby shampoo. Just remember to rinse the shampoo out completely. No matter what kind of shampoo you use, baby or cat shampoo. Like us, if we don't rinse our hair well, we get itchy scalp. Kitty will also be itchy and get dry skin and fur, not good. Rinse the shampoo out real well until you see just water coming off of your cat. Hope this helped!
